## Changed defaults

Bouncewright 4.2 changes default handling of soft bounces. Retries now cap at 5 instead of 12, and the quarantine window shrinks from 72h to 24h. Suppression-list sync is enabled by default; previously opt-in. Anyone upgrading from 3.x should audit overrides, since several deployments relied on the old retry cap to paper over slow upstream relays. Hard-bounce behavior is unchanged. No migration script is required; defaults apply on restart. The new effective defaults are listed below.

settings of fafog-haduf:
ZORIX_PIN=4648
ZORIX_METRICS_HOST=metrics.zorix.paliqsys.corp
ZORIX_LOG_LEVEL=info
ZORIX_TENANT=druix

Handover — Launch Plan, Corvale Meter Pro

From: D. Aldenmark
To: R. Sivelli

Launch moved to Q3. Pricing locked at tiered model; finance to confirm margin floors by month-end. Channel partners briefed: Ostreva and Lundqvist Retail only. Marketing spend capped per the revised budget — no exceptions without sign-off. Inventory pre-build starts at the Tarnby plant in six weeks. Outstanding items: warranty terms, freight contracts, returns policy. All figures in the shared ledger. Review the appended note before your first steering call.

board note of baweg-bawig: Project Tamath slips by six weeks because of the audit delay.

Heads up: the Tilefetch prefetcher is the thing that keeps Wayfarer's maps snappy in low-signal regions. It predicts the next viewport and pulls tiles ahead of time from the Gridhaven edge nodes. If it falls behind, you'll see the `prefetch_lag` alert — usually a stuck worker, just restart it. To hit the Gridhaven admin endpoint during an incident, use the key below.

gateway credential: kto23_LX9A4ys6i4nzHtpOLNLodKK